Dr. Tarig Ali is a Professor in the Department of Civil Engineering at the American University of Sharjah. He received a MS and a PhD from the Department of Civil, Environmental and Geodetic Engineering from the The Ohio State University in 1999 and 2003, respectively. He has taught at East Tennessee State University (ETSU) and the University of Central Florida (UCF). He is a member of the American Society of Civil Engineers, the Institute of Electrical and Electronics Engineers, and the International Society for Photogrammetry and Remote Sensing. He is the recipient of the Earle J. Fennell Award, the Esri Award for Best Scientific Paper in Geographic Information Systems, the ETSU Faculty Excellence Award, the American Shore and Beach Preservation Educational Award, and The Ohio State University’s Duane C. Brown Jr. Award. His research interests include Coastal Mapping, Spatial Analytics, Remote Sensing and Coastal Ecosystems, and Geospatial Artificial Intelligence (GeoAI).
